Nobody had been angry with Leo for running after Raph. After all, how could they blame him for something that he had been doing for basically all his life?
Instead, they had been relieved and made Leo promise never to go out alone ever again. Leo had just laughed.
..................(in the morning)
Everyone woke up to the smell of Mikey cooking. The lovely smell of scrambled eggs (again) and burnt toast (again).
Splinter sighed. He probably should be happy that his son had not burnt the whole kitchen down by now, but he should get cooking lessons, Splinter decided. Suddenly, a small green blur shot passed him, heading for the kitchen.
Splinter chuckled. His now youngest son was indeed eager to get the morning started, it seems. He sighed. Today was the first official day that Leo was a child. Splinter chuckled again. Leonardo had barely been a child for a day and he was already causing trouble. He thought, remembering last night.
Splinter entered the kitchen to where April had taken over the cooking, while Casey, Donatello and Raphael were playing 'catch' with the plates. Splinter cleared his throat and immediately the three stopped what they were doing and sheepishly set the table. Leo, like a hyperactive puppy, was running around the table, seemingly excited that everyone was here.
Suddenly, there was a faint knock on the door. Splinter, who was the closest, opened the door to reveal Mr. Mortu.
Mortu bowed a little before speaking. "I hope I am not disturbing..."
Splinter smiled gently in order to reassure him that he was not disturbing. "No, Mr. Mortu. Please come inside."
Mortu smiled and thanked him. "The reason for my visit," he started, as he stepped inside. "Is to check on Leonardo."
Mikey giggled. "I think he's fine..." He said, looking under the table before getting tackled by Leo.
Leo triumphantly jumped off of Mikey, before trotting over to Mortu.
Mortu and Splinter chuckled, before Mortu leaned down and picked Leo up. "I see." He said, before putting Leo onto a chair beside him. Leo, sensing that something important was going to happen, stilled.
Mortu meanwhile, took out a small needle from his pocket and a bandage. Looking at Splinter he explained. "We require a blood sample so that we can begin to find a cure."
Splinter nodded as a sign that he understands. Mortu, then, reached for Leo.
Leo, sensing that the man meant no harm and that this was important, allowed Mortu to take one of his arms and take a blood sample.
Once Mortu was finished, he nodded to the small turtle, who jumped off of the chair and proceeded to chase Mikey around the table.
Mortu pocketed the sample, bowed to Splinter, and left.
........................(after breakfast)
Splinter, like every morning, had called his sons together for training in a separate room.
Mikey groaned. "Man! Why do we have to train while Leo gets to have the day off?" He whined, watching the now youngest turtle playing tug-of-war with Casey in the living room.
Splinter gave his son a reprimanding look. "Leonardo is currently in no position to train with us."
Raph growled and twirled his Sais. "Still. It ain't fair, Master Splinter!"
Splinter sighed. "Do not worry Raphael. Once Leonardo is back in his original form, he will be given extra training tasks in order to catch up."
This seemed to satisfy the three turtles. They all climbed up onto the top of the poles and began to balance while fighting off Splinter in the dark.
Suddenly Mikey stopped. "Hey! Doesn't anyone get the feeling that we're being watched?"
Raph laughed. "Don't be an idiot, Mikey."
Mikey growled. "No! Really!" He growled before clapping his hands for the lights to come on.
As soon as they did, Mikey yelled in surprise before loosing his balance and toppling off of the pole.
Leo, who had been crouching in front of him on all fours, looked down at his bigger brother in surprise.
Don and Raph laughed. "Gotta hand it to ya Mikey. Ya weren't being an idiot!" Raph said, landing next to Mikey before helping him up. Mikey stuck his tongue out at Raph.
"Well how was I supposed to know that Leo was right in front of me???"
Splinter sighed. "Leonardo! I have told you to stay outside while your brothers are training!"
Leo turned to look at Splinter. "Wanna stay! Need practice!" He said, looking up at Splinter.
Don chuckled at that. "Some things never change!"
Splinter ignored the comment. "Leonardo..." He said sternly. Leo dropped his gaze before standing up onto two legs and hopping down from the pole, before landing gracefully on two's and sinking back down to fours.
Raph growled. "Even when he's a kid he's graceful!"
Leo grinned at the comment before sticking his tongue out at Raph. Raph growled and jumped at him. Leo just jumped up and landed behind Raph before jumping up again and kicking Raph on the shell.
Normally, that kick would have caused Raph to go sailing, but now it only made Raph go forwards a bit before catching his balance. Turning around, he jumped at Leo again, who this time side-stepped, causing Raph to crash to the ground.
Donny and Mikey by now where clutching their sides in laughter.
"What's up, Raph? Can't handle a four-year-old?" Don teased, while laughing even harder at his brothers futile efforts to catch Leo. Raph growled at him before pausing to get a breather. "Why don't you try it, Mr. I-can-handle-anything?"
Don smirked. "Fine, I will!" He was about to go at Leo, when Splinter cleared his throat.
"Maybe later. Right now, you have training to do." He said, fighting back a chuckle. 'This is going to be a very long three days...' He thought.
And Splinter had no clue just how right he was.
